Education in Puerto Rico - Problems

Problems

  • The Department of Education in 2005 had a deficit of (US$783 million).
  • In a 2002 scandal, Victor Fajardo, a former Secretary of the Department of Education was found guilty of stealing federal funds for financing political campaigns.
  • Dropout Rate is as high as 40%.
